Mathematics anxiety is a phenomenon characterized by feelings of tension and nervousness towards math (Ashcraft, 2002). Unsurprisingly, it has been extensively documented to be negatively associated with mathematical performance (Ramirez et al., 2018). Research consistently shows that math anxiety impacts cognitive processing abilities and diminishes working memory resources, leading to poorer problem-solving skills and lower achievement in mathematical tasks (Ashcraft & Krause, 2007; Ramirez et al., 2013). It is important to consider students with different math anxiety levels and patterns when creating new math learning interventions, as math anxiety affects how students perceive and learn from mathematical interventions. Recognizing and accommodating the diverse math interventions to math anxiety can help create more effective learning environments.
